About C. Lidman

C. Lidman is a scholar working on Astronomy and Astrophysics, Instrumentation, Atomic and Molecular Physics, and Optics, Nuclear and High Energy Physics and Computational Mechanics, having authored 133 papers that have together received 3.1k indexed citations. Recurring topics across this work include Galaxies: Formation, Evolution, Phenomena (83 papers), Astronomy and Astrophysical Research (69 papers), Stellar, planetary, and galactic studies (52 papers), Gamma-ray bursts and supernovae (39 papers), Astrophysical Phenomena and Observations (27 papers), Adaptive optics and wavefront sensing (17 papers), Astrophysics and Cosmic Phenomena (16 papers) and Radio Astronomy Observations and Technology (11 papers). The work is most often cited by research in Instrumentation (1.4k citations), Astronomy and Astrophysics (3.0k citations), Nuclear and High Energy Physics (554 citations), Statistical and Nonlinear Physics (92 citations) and Atomic and Molecular Physics, and Optics (200 citations). C. Lidman has collaborated with scholars based in United States, Australia and Chile. Frequent co-authors include R. Demarco, P. Rosati, Adam Muzzin, Gillian Wilson, A. F. M. Moorwood, H. K. C. Yee, J. G. Cuby, S. A. Stanford, Allison Noble and Henk Hoekstra. Their work appears in journals such as Monthly Notices of the Royal Astronomical Society, Astronomy and Astrophysics, The Astrophysical Journal, Publications of the Astronomical Society of Australia and The Astrophysical Journal Letters.
